Emergency Water Extraction
The first step after a plumbing failure is always to remove standing water. We use powerful pumps and extractors to pull out as much water as possible, minimizing saturation. This stage is critical to prevent further damage and usually takes a few hours, depending on the volume of water.
Drying and Dehumidification
Once the bulk of the water is gone, we deploy specialized drying equipment. Indust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ers work tirelessly to pull moisture out of the air and building materials like drywall and wood. This process can take several days, as our goal is to reach pre-loss humidity levels.
Moisture Detection and Assessment
We don’t guess where the water has gone. Our technicians use advanced mo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to pinpoint hidden moisture in walls, floors, and ceilings. This ensures we dry every affected area thoroughly, which is vital for preventing secondary damage.
Odor Control
Water damage often brings unpleasant odors. We employ professional-grade deodorizers and ozone treatments to neutralize smells caused by the water and potential microbial growth. This step is essential for restoring a fresh and healthy environment in your home.
Structural Drying and Repair Planning
After initial drying, we assess any materials that may have been compromised. We determine what needs to be removed and replaced, like damaged drywall or subflooring. Our team then coordinates any necessary repairs to restore your property’s structure and appearance.

Warning Signs You Need Plumbing Failure Water Damage Restoration
Catching the signs of water damage early can save you a lot of headaches and money down the line. Ignoring them allows moisture to spread, weakening your home and potentially creating health hazards. Early detection is key to a successful restoration. Don’t overlook these signals.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ent, musty smell often indicates hidden moisture. This could be in walls, under floors, or in crawl spaces. This odor is a warning that mold might be starting to grow.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Look for new or spreading stains on ceilings, walls, or floors. These marks are direct evidence of water intrusion. These stains signal a leak that needs immediate attention.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int/Wallpaper
When moisture gets behind paint or wallpaper, it can cause them to lose adhesion and bubble up. This is a clear sign that water is trapped behind the surface.
Warped or Sagging Floors/Ceilings
Excessive moisture can cause wood or drywall to swell and warp. This structural change indicates significant water saturation and potential weakening.
Soft or Spongy Areas on Floors
If parts of your floor feel soft or give way when you walk on them, it’s likely due to water saturation underneath. This compromised subfloor needs professional assessment and drying.
Unexplained High Water Bills
A sudden spike in your water bill, even without increased usage, can point to an undetected leak. This hidden leak could be causing continuous water damage.
Plumbing Failure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minor Puddle from a Toilet Overflows | Yes, for immediate cleanup of surface water. | Yes, if water seeped under baseboards or into flooring. | Hidden moisture can cause serious issues if not properly dried. |
| Burst Pipe with Significant Water Flow | No. | Yes, absolutely. | Rapid water spread requires powerful extraction and drying equipment. |
| Leaking Washing Machine Hose | Yes, to clean up small spills. | Yes, if water spread beyond the immediate area. | Water under cabinets or behind appliances is hard to reach and dry. |
| Slow, Constant Drip from a Fixture | Yes, to monitor and tighten. | Yes, if the drip has caused visible staining or damage. | Persistent moisture can lead to mold and structural compromise over time. |
| Water Heater Leak | No. | Yes, especially if water is extensive. | Water heaters can leak large amounts of water, requiring specialized handling and safety protocols. |
| Sewage Backup (often linked to plumbing failure) | Absolutely Not. | Yes, immediately. | Sewage contains hazardous bio-contaminants and requires professional sanitation and cleanup. |
For any plumbing failure that results in more than a small puddle, calling a professional is the safest bet. DIY efforts rarely address the hidden moisture that leads to mold and structural decay. Our trained technicians have the equipment and expertise to handle it properly.
Plumbing Failure Water Damage Restoration Cost In Seville, AZ
The cost of plumbing failure water damage restoration in Seville, AZ, can vary greatly. Factors like the extent of the water damage, the size of the affected area, and the type of materials involved all play a role. These are estimated ranges and a proper assessment is needed for an exact quote.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, size of affected rooms, accessibility. |
| Structural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000+ | Duration of drying needed, size of the space, number of units required. |
| Mold Inspection and Remediation | $750 – $3,000+ | Severity of mold growth, size of affected area, containment needs. |
| Odor Removal Services | $300 – $1,000 | Type of odor, extent of saturation, required treatment methods. |
| Minor Drywall/Subfloor Replacement | $500 – $2,000 per room | Square footage of damage, material costs, complexity of repair. |
| Full Water Damage Assessment | Often included with restoration services or a small fee ($150-$300) applied to restoration work. | Complexity of the damage, need for specialized detection equipment. |

Common Questions About Plumbing Failure Water Damage Restoration
What’s the first thing I should do if a pipe bursts in my home?
The very first step is to shut off the main water supply to your home to stop further flooding. Then, safely remove as much standing water as you can if it’s a small amount. Call our team immediately to begin the professional extraction and drying process, preventing secondary damage.
How long does plumbing water damage restoration usually take?
The timeline varies significantly based on the severity of the damage. Initial water extraction might take a few hours. The drying and dehumidification process typically takes 3-5 days, but severe cases can take longer. We’ll provide a more accurate estimate after our initial assessment.
Is plumbing water damage covered by homeowner’s insurance?
Generally, homeowner’s insurance covers damage from sudden and accidental plumbing failures, like a burst pipe. However, it usually doesn’t cover damage from lack of maintenance or slow leaks. What are the health risks associated with plumbing water damage if not cleaned properly?
Untreated water damage can lead to mold and mildew growth, which can cause respiratory problems, allergies, and other health issues. Harmful bacteria can also thrive in damp environments. Proper drying and sanitation by our certified technicians are essential for your family’s health.
Can I just dry wet carpet myself after a plumbing leak?
For minor spills, you might be able to dry it, but for most plumbing failures, especially those involving standing water or hidden moisture, professional intervention is needed. DIY drying often isn’t sufficient to remove all the moisture from the padding and subfloor. Our specialized equipment ensures thorough drying to prevent mold and structural damage.
